Monday, January 5, 2009


On New Years Eve, this routine pat down turns fatal when a police officer detains Oscar Grant while another officer reaches for his gun and shoots Grant in the back.

For reasons unknown to us, the police officer pushed Grant to the ground. One officer kneeled on his neck while the other officer pulled out a gun and shot him point blank in the back. The bullet went through his back, hit the ground and bounced back up and pierced his lung, killing him.

Our prayers go to the Grant family as they try to cope with this tragedy.


Related Posts with Thumbnails